Python kullanarak Word'e İçindekiler Tablosu ekleme

Bu kısa makaledeki adımlara uyarak Python kullanarak Word içine bir içindekiler tablosu ekleyin. Gerekli kaynakları, uygulamayı yazmaya yönelik programlama adımlarının bir listesini ve Python kullanarak Word’de içerik sayfasının nasıl ekleneceğini gösteren örnek bir kodu sağlayarak ortamın yapılandırılmasına yardımcı olur. İçeriklerini ayrıştırarak mevcut bir Word belgesine TOC eklemeyi öğreneceksiniz.

Python kullanarak Word’de İçindekiler Tablosu Oluşturma Adımları

  1. İçindekiler eklenecek metni dönüştürmek için .NET aracılığıyla Aspose.Words for Python‘ı yükleyerek ortamı ayarlayın
  2. Word dosyasına Document sınıfı nesnesine erişin ve DocumentBuilder nesnesini başlatın
  3. İçindekiler başlığını istediğiniz stille ekleyin
  4. İçindekiler tablosunu ekleyin ve sayfa sonu ekleyin
  5. Varsayılan boş içindekiler tablosunu doldurun
  6. İçinde TOC bulunan Word dosyasını kaydedin

Çok basit adımları izleyerek Python kullanarak Word’e içindekiler sayfasını ekleyebilirsiniz; burada süreç, Document sınıfını kullanarak Word dosyasını yükleyerek başlayacak ve içindekiler tablosu eklemeyi destekleyen DocumentBuilder sınıfı nesnesini yapılandıracaktır. Insert_table_of_contents() yöntemini kullanarak başlığı ve içindekiler tablosunu ekleyin ve update_fields() yöntemini çağırarak varsayılan boş içindekiler tablosunu doldurun.

Python kullanarak Word’de İçindekiler Tablosu Oluşturma Kodu

Python kullanarak Word’de içindekiler sayfası oluşturmak için bu örnek kodu kullanın. insert_table_of_contents() yöntemi, içindekiler tablosunun davranışını kontrol etmek için anahtarlar gerektirir; örneğin Başlık 1, 2 ve 3’ü adreslemek için 1-3, köprüleri kullanmak için ‘\h’ ve köprüleri kullanmak için ‘\u’ kullanılır. Anahat seviyelerini ayarlamak için kullanılır. Varsayılan İçerik Tablosu (TOC) boştur ve update_fields() yöntemi kullanılarak doldurulur.

Bu konu bizi Python kullanarak Word’de içindekiler tablosunun nasıl ekleneceğini aydınlattı. Word dosyasındaki metni döndürme hakkında bilgi edinmek için Python kullanarak Word’deki metni döndürme hakkındaki makaleye bakın.

 Türkçe